perhaps this will give you an idea why we need your "dream team" at lvl 100 with max everything and all stats listed out, as well as movesets and items...
Ingame battle:
Chikorita > Dragonite (100% win rate). Sounds stupid right? but in ingame that can be done... on the other hand when it's in competitive gameplay, Chikorita's winning percentage will drop dramatically to a let's say.. 5% max? Due to the great difference in stats... always post at lvl 100, with your "dream moveset", personality, item attachment and EV distribution

DragonTrainer
October 29th, 2003, 07:53 PM
Now this I can help with!
Blaziken Adamant @Salac Berry
-Bulk Up
-Brick Break/Sky Uppercut
-E Quake
-Overheat
SkarmoryBold@Leftovers/Chesto berry
-Spikes
-Toxic
-Drill Peck
-Roar/Rest
Alakazam Modest@Leftovers
-Calm Mind
-Psychic
-Thunderpunch
-Recover
Kyogre Modest@Leftovers
-Surf/Water Spout
-Thunder
-Ice Beam
-Calm mind
Rhydon Adamant@Chesto Berry
-Swords Dance
-E Quake
-Megahorn
-Rest
Steelix Adamant@Quick Claw
-Explosion
-E Quake
-Rock Slide
-Roar
How about that?You have 2 ground types, and two steel types, maybe you could switch to different ones
